Interview with a Vampire is one of the biggest cult films of the 1990s. In fact, the horror film starring Tom Cruise and Brad Pitt goes back a bit further: it is based on the 1976 novel of the same name by Anne Rice. Now the scary vampire story is being remade as a series.

On October 2, 2022, the 1st season of Interview With the Vampire will premiere on AMC. The series is the new beacon of hope for the US channel, which will have to say goodbye to two big series this year, or has already had to say goodbye to one: Better Call Saul and The Walking Dead.

After the cult film with Tom Cruise and Brad Pitt comes Interview with a Vampire as a series

There’s a lot of potential in Interview With the Vampire – so much, in fact, that AMC has renewed the series for a 2nd season ahead of its launch, Variety reports. Last but not least, the project has been very well received by critics. At Metracritic, Interview With the Vampire currently averages a score of 81 out of 100.

Matthew Gilbert of the Boston Globe has nothing but praise for the series. It does change individual details from the original, which might upset fans, but the result “works spectacularly well.” Carly Lane of Collider adds that Interview With the Vampire feels like a “gritty exploration of sex and violence” that is “heartbreaking and turns our stomachs.”

An intriguing comparison comes from Brian Tallerico at The Playlist : Interview With the Vampire could be the series child of True Blood and Hannibal. That definitely sounds tempting. After being in development for over five years, it seems that a really strong adaptation has now emerged.

The creative mind behind this adaptation is Rolin Jones. In the past he has worked on series such as Weeds – Small Deals Among Neighbours, Friday Night Lights and Boardwalk Empire. Now he is overseeing Interview With the Vampire as showrunner. The roles of Cruise and Pitt are embodied by Sam Reid (The Limehouse Golem) and Jacob Anderson (Grey Worm from Game of Thrones).
